Answer to Question 1

Answers can include any three of the following:
Creates a favorable impression by arousing the reader's interest with the first sentence
Appeals to the reader's point of view
Correct in spelling and grammar
Avoids jargon and stilted phrases
Courteous, friendly, and sincere, promoting goodwill
Accurate, clear, concise, and complete
Flows smoothly
Concludes by telling the reader how to respond
Concludes on a positive note
